What Are High Tensile Fasteners?

Simply put, high tensile fasteners are bolts, nuts, screws, or washers designed to handle higher stress and load​ than standard fasteners. Think of them as the “weightlifters” of the fastener world! They’re made from robust materials like alloy steel or stainless steel and undergo heat treatment to boost their strength. Common grades you might spot are 8.8, 10.9, and 12.9—the higher the number, the stronger the fastener .

Why does this matter? Well, in critical applications—say, securing a skyscraper’s steel beams or an aircraft’s engine—using a regular fastener just won’t cut it. High tensile options ensure things don’t shake loose when it counts .

Key Advantages: More Than Just Muscle

Here’s why engineers and builders swear by them:

  • Superior Strength: They resist stretching, bending, or snapping under heavy loads. For example, Grade 10.9 bolts can handle tensile strengths up to 1,040 MPa—that’s like supporting the weight of several cars! .

  • Durability: Thanks to materials like chromium or molybdenum alloys, these fasteners fight off wear, fatigue, and even corrosion. Some are galvanized or coated with zinc for extra protection in harsh environments .

  • Safety First: In industries like aerospace or automotive, a failed bolt can spell disaster. High tensile fasteners add a layer of reliability, meeting strict standards like ASTM or ISO .

  • Lightweight Efficiency: Despite their strength, they’re often lighter than traditional options, helping reduce overall structure weight .

️ Where Are They Used? (Spoiler: Almost Everywhere!)

From the depths of the ocean to outer space, high tensile fasteners are unsung heroes:

  • Construction & Bridges: They lock steel structures together, ensuring stability in everything from stadiums to suspension bridges .

  • Automotive & Aerospace: Ever think about what holds your car’s engine or a plane’s wings in place? Yep—high tensile bolts .

  • Energy Sector: Wind turbines and oil rigs rely on them to withstand vibrations, pressure, and corrosive elements .

  • Heavy Machinery: Mining equipment or agricultural gear uses these fasteners to endure constant stress .

How to Choose the Right High Tensile Fastener?

Picking the right one isn’t just about gra*g the strongest option! Here’s a quick checklist:

  1. Know Your Load: Calculate the tension, shear, or vibration the fastener will face. For dynamic loads (e.g., machinery), fatigue resistance is key .

  2. Check the Grade: Match the grade to your needs—e.g., 8.8 for general use, 12.9 for extreme conditions .

  3. Material & Coating: In wet or corrosive environments, stainless steel or zinc-plated options last longer .
